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
932 7691216 92888185188 4749891
204334 81
204334 81
4251406 058 910932 19070
All about undefined
Interested in learning more?
204334 81
4251406 058 910932 19070
See more
129 94740640 71491
48 710575 9061640 39
See more
938349 32317361680 7866437
3195640 507561 49 209951913 5545482
See more